Chaos Illustrations in Dynamics of Mechanisms

2020 
The paper illustrates the occurrence of chaos phenomenon when dynamic modelling of a mechanical system is performed. The equations of motion of a 2DOF physical planar pendulum are obtained and subsequently they are numerically integrated. The same system is also modelled using dedicated software. The numerical results and the ones given by the software coincide only for a short duration after launching. The paper highlights the strong dependence of the evolution of the system upon the initial conditions, confirming the existence of the chaos phenomenon. It is also revealed the connection between the accuracy of the initial conditions and the dimension of the corresponding interval.
